5-Amino-1MQ
5-Amino-1MQ is a selective NNMT inhibitor that boosts NAD+ levels. Preclinical data shows anti-obesity and muscle function benefits. No human trials published.
Carnosine
Carnosine: endogenous dipeptide with anti-glycation, antioxidant, and pH-buffering properties. Phase 2 trials in diabetes, cognition, and anti-aging applications.

Klotho Peptides
Klotho peptides (KP1, KP6) are synthetic fragments of the alpha-klotho anti-aging protein. Research covers kidney fibrosis, diabetic nephropathy, FGF23/FGF21 signaling, cognitive enhancement, and neuroprotection in preclinical models.

OS-01 (Peptide 14)
OS-01 (Peptide 14) is a senotherapeutic decapeptide targeting cellular senescence via PP2A modulation. Published RCT data shows skin barrier and aging improvements.
